A series resonant LCR circuit has a quality factor (Q-factor)=0.4. If `R=2k Omega, C=0.1 mu F` then the value of inductance is

A

0.1 H

B

0.064 H

C

2 H

D

5 H

Text Solution

Verified by Experts

The correct Answer is:
B
